Question

Construct the truth table of the following:

[(p ∧ q) ∨ r] ∧ [∼r ∨ (p ∧ q)]

Sum
Advertisements

Solution

p q r p∧q (p∧q) ∨ r ∼r ∼r ∨ (p∧q) [(p∧q) ∨ r] ∧ [∼r ∨ (p∧q)]
T T T T T F T T
T T F T T T T T
T F T F T F F F
T F F F F T T F
F T T F T F F F
F T F F F T T F
F F T F T F F F
F F F F F T T F
